#63318c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#63318c is composed of 38.8% red, 19.2% green and 54.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 29.3% cyan, 65% magenta, 0% yellow and 45.1% black. It has a hue angle of 273 degrees, a saturation of 48.1% and a lightness of 37.1%. #63318c color hex could be obtained by blending #c662ff with #000019.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

● #63318c color description : Dark moderate violet.
#63318c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#63318c has RGB values of R:99, G:49, B:140 and CMYK values of C:0.29, M:0.65, Y:0,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 6500748.

Shades and Tints of #63318c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070309 is the darkest color, while #fcfaf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#63318c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f5d60 is the less saturated color, while #6705b8 is the most saturated one.
